Economic and Industry Overview
Oswego's economy is predominantly driven by agriculture and small-scale manufacturing, which create a steady demand for industrial and commercial properties. The presence of fertile land and access to key agricultural markets make it a hotbed for agribusiness ventures. Additionally, local economic development initiatives, such as those led by Labette County Economic Development, aim to diversify the economic base, fostering growth in logistics and value-added manufacturing sectors.
Strategic Location and Transportation Infrastructure
Oswego boasts a strategic location with access to key transportation networks. It is in proximity to major highways such as US-59 and US-160, which facilitate efficient logistics and distribution. The city is also served by the South Kansas & Oklahoma Railroad, offering freight rail services that enhance its connectivity to regional and national markets. Major Employers and Institutions
Oswego is home to several major employers and institutions that contribute to CRE demand. Notable employers include the Labette Health hospital system and the Oswego Unified School District. Additionally, the presence of Labette Community College enriches the local workforce, providing educational resources and training opportunities that support business growth.
